How to turn off automatic switching between users cameras?

How to turn off this automatic between users camera mode? Is it possible? I would like to record only one camera, no matter whos speaking. Its neccessary for recordings. I dont want to record me, i need the view on my interviewee all the time. Please help me how to do it.

If recording in the cloud and have at least 3 people with cameras on, I think using Spotlight is the best way to go.

If you're recording locally and have at least 2 video cameras on, you can Pin the other person's video.  Just note you can't change your viewing layout or it'll affect what is seen on the recording.
